A leading biopharma company in Singapore is seeking an experienced engineer to lead key activities in ensuring manufacturing reliability and safety. The role involves overseeing maintenance, troubleshooting complex equipment issues, and coaching junior staff. Candidates should have significant experience in a regulated environment, particularly in biological manufacturing, and familiarity with relevant safety and quality standards. This position offers opportunities for professional growth and impactful contributions to the team.
You will lead technical engineering activities that keep our manufacturing site reliable, safe and inspection ready. You will work closely with operators, project teams and external suppliers. We value clear problem solvers who mentor others and drive continuous improvement. GSK is a global biopharma company with a purpose to unite science, technology and talent to get ahead of disease together. We aim to positively impact the health of 2.5 billion people by the end of the decade, as a successful, growing company where people can thrive. We get ahead of disease by preventing and treating it with innovation in specialty medicines and vaccines. We focus on four therapeutic areas: respiratory, immunology and inflammation; oncology; HIV; and infectious diseases – to impact health at scale.
